In my sites there are headers and footer templates. I can see the problem is that {acf_color_xxx} returns an empty string (only in templates). I send you two screenshots more.
Hey @dmonje, sorry, I didn’t make it earlier. But I found the culprit. It works as expected when you change the CSS loading method back to Inline styles.
There are multiple reports of problems with the External files option in 1.7.1. So maybe you add a comment to one of those threads describing your specific problem.
